What is the best time to visit India?
In India, the climate is not divided into four seasons like in Vietnam, but into three: the rainy season, summer, and winter. The summer lasts from March to May with quite hot weather. The rainy season, from June to October, brings slightly lower temperatures, making it less hot, but the downside is the rain. Winter in India lasts from December through February, and although it's considered winter, it only gets slightly chilly at night; during the day, it's cool and comfortable. According to travelers, winter is the best time to book flights to India.
However, if you can't manage to find time for winter, summer from March to May is still a decent option. As for the rainy season, you should think carefully before planning, as the rain might disrupt your travels and sightseeing adventures.

Aside from the rainy months, you can visit India for spiritual tourism all year round
Which spiritual destinations should you visit in India?
India is known as the 'birthplace of Buddhism,' so if you're planning a spiritual journey to India, make sure to note down the following remarkable destinations to visit.
- Bodh Gaya (Bodh Gaya)
This is the name of a city located in the Bihar region of India. It may not be a very popular destination among tourists, but it is well-known to those who have an interest in spiritual tourism. According to legend, it is the place where the Buddha attained enlightenment under the Bodhi tree, a story that holds great significance in the spread of Buddhism worldwide today.
- Sarnath – The Holy Land of Buddhism
Known as the holy land of Buddhism, Sarnath is also the place where the Buddha first delivered his teachings in the process of spreading Buddhist doctrine to all beings.
